Antibiotic use in relation to the risk of breast cancer

CM Velicer, SR Heckbert, JW Lampe, JD Potter… - Jama, 2004 - jamanetwork.com
ContextUse of antibiotics may be associated with risk of breast cancer through effects on
immune function, inflammation, and metabolism of estrogen and phytochemicals; however,
clinical data on the association between antibiotic use and risk of breast cancer are sparse.
ObjectiveTo examine the association between use of antibiotics and risk of breast cancer.
Design, Setting, and ParticipantsCase-control study among 2266 women older than 19
